Christine Quinn's ex is paying $27K a month on empty mansion
Share this @internewscast.com

Christian Dumontet, the estranged husband of Christine Quinn, is currently facing a financial burden, as he spends $27,000 each month on a Los Angeles property they once lived in together. He is seeking sole legal ownership of the home to facilitate its sale and alleviate his financial strain.

Dumontet, who is 47, has requested the court to grant him legal ownership of the residence, intending to settle the mortgage. This information was revealed in court documents he submitted on Friday in Los Angeles, which the Daily Mail reviewed.

The former partner of the Netflix celebrity hopes to sell the property quickly to halt the financial drain linked to maintaining an asset that doesn’t generate income.

In his court statement, the entrepreneur mentioned that he acquired the property as an investment in 2019, months before marrying the Dallas-born Quinn, who is 37.

Dumontet disclosed to the court that he is facing a $3.5 million mortgage debt and has been pouring thousands into the property’s rent, security, and maintenance costs.

‘This is not sustainable,’ Dumontet said in court docs. ‘I require immediate court intervention to stop this financial hemorrhaging.’

Dumontet and Quinn, best known for appearing on the Netflix series Selling Sunset, are parents to son Christian, four.

They parted in March of 2024 following a series of alleged domestic violence incidents in which Quinn obtained a temporary restraining order, leading to Dumontet being arrested twice within a span of hours.

Dumontet, who formerly went by the name Christian Richard, said in his latest court filing that the series of events in his personal life left him unable ‘to act with respect’ to the home.

He said in his court filing that when he was allowed to return to the home and make changes, he invested thousands into repairs and renovations.

Dumontet said he is currently residing in France with his girlfriend and their one-year-old son, and needs sole ownership to move forward with a critical sale.

Quinn doesn’t live in the home, and hasn’t since around September of 2025, Dumontet said in his filing. 

Quinn ‘has never made any financial contribution … whether toward the purchase price, mortgage payments, carrying costs, maintenance, or otherwise,’ Dumontet told the court.

Quinn is ‘not on the hook’ monetarily for any of the costs resulting from the mortgage and repairs, Dumontet told the court.

‘I alone am suffering this harm, and without court intervention, I will continue to,’ Dumontet said.

The emergency order request was subsequently denied by the court.

Quinn moved back to her native Texas in the wake of her split with Dumontet.

Speaking with People last year, the reality star said she was ‘really, really grateful to be living here,’ so close to relatives.

‘I have a sister who lives really close to me, and my son has a cousin. I found a wonderful house,’ she told the outlet. ‘I would say it’s, like, 60 percent done, but there’s still some things that I want to do and really take it to the next level because I love interior design.’
